#d622a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d622a2 is composed of 83.9% red, 13.3%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 317.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#d622a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#ad0045.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d622a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d622a2 has RGB values of R:214, G:34,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.24,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14033570.

Shades and Tints of #d622a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0208 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d622a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80787e is the less saturated color, while #f305ae is the most saturated one.
